Transaction

09fb3b51fb1c27071076c1252c430ac59289633565a117d3c3a43018793b0041

Summary

In Block683386
TimeSat, 04 May 2024 19:41:00 UTC
Total Input546.699981 Nebula
Total Output580.699981 Nebula
Fees0 Nebula

Details

Raw Transaction